Kerrie Droban is the host and creator of the “CRIME STANDS STILL” podcast, a docuseries that follows one case every Season. Season One features the sensational Arizona story of Marjorie Orbin, a woman wrongfully convicted of the brutal and shocking beheading of her former husband and currently serving a life sentence. Season One, “Firefly,” was written and produced with the permission and encouragement of my client, Marjorie Orbin, whom I have represented in post-conviction for over ten years. The Women, Ted Bundy's Ultimate "Cover" 24.02.2026 18:51
Bundy understood that women conferred safety. When women vouched for him—romantically, socially, or publicly—it neutralized suspicion. A man surrounded by women who trusted him appeared vetted . Their presence became proof of his normalcy. "If women trust him, he can't be dangerous." That assumption did enormous work on his behalf. The Frankston Murders | A Case of Random Violence in Plain Sight 09.01.2026 17:43
Frankston was supposed to be safe. A place you walked through. A place you didn't think about. In the winter of 1993, that illusion collapsed. Three young women— Deborah Fream, Elizabeth Stevens, and Natalie Russell —were murdered in public spaces across this quiet Australian suburb. No connection. No warning. No pattern anyone could avoid.
